Delfeayo Marsalis, Branford's brother and the producer of this record, provides such studied liner notes you would think he was lecturing a class of Mensa students majoring in history and musicology. Such serious verbiage is usually reserved for the other Marsalis brother, Wynton. We all know that Branford is the fun one. After all, Branford co-starred in Throw Momma From the Train and kidded around with Jay Leno every evening when he led the Tonight Show band. But appearances can be deceiving. Branford has always been a serious musician above and beyond jazz and very capable of a broad range of expression, which has included a fair share of classical music.

"The Beautyful Ones Are Not Yet Born" is not classical music. It is jazz. But there is no joviality in its playing. It is a somber ballad with a serious intent, and requires serious attention from the listener. Delfeayo writes that the tune has a "…free, yet structured harmony." I suppose that is an apt description. At its midpoint, Marsalis has a long expressive solo that builds in momentum. During his deep exploration on soprano sax, Branford sounds very much like Coltrane. This is not "sit back and relax" music.
By Walter Kolosky.

If you like good jazz "in the tradition," this is a must for any jazz collector. "Roused About" has a great monkish feel to it (named after one of Monk's tenor players). "The Beautyful Ones" is a sublime ballad, and reminds me of Coltrane's meditative pieces like "Alabama"-- but very "operatic" in some sense. The musical approach is largely free, and emotionally tense, but not necessarily atonal (think 60's Miles Davis, not Ornette Coleman). If you are into Kenny G, don't buy this album **THIS IS REAL JAZZ** not instrumental pop!
By Joshua Sellers.
